Netrani is gentle, but a little buoyancy control makes the reef diving more rewarding and keeps fins off the coral. Around 10 dives is the point where it clicks.
How do I get there?
Fly or take the train to Mangalore or Gokarna, then reach Murudeshwar by road. We share the exact logistics once your slot is confirmed.
Is February a good time?
Yes. Winter gives this coast its calmest seas and clearest water of the year.
